>From what I can figure out it looks like lorax-0.4.4-1.fc15 uses and
needs more memory
I can run Fedora 15 in full shell on our slowest 1.5 Ghz laptop with
256mb memory and it runs faster
than f14, I do an install with 512MB than take out stick. The live cd
as of May6 that I made using
the repo.../development/15/i386/os/ only, does a full install without
problems, it doesn't seem to use
lorax for the install. But if we make the minimum 768 for anaconda
than I will no longer be able
to even do a livecd install to these machines, that we have since
2004, installed
Fedora on them and than given them away to needy families in our area.
Is there a way to have anaconda have a minimum requirements for
install and a separate minimum
requirements for a live install? These systems are donated to us we
refurbish them and then they go back out
loaded with Fedora to students and families in need.
